The Benefits of Walking Treadmills

Walking treadmills are created to improve physical fitness without the joint stress associated with running. Here are a few of the primary benefits:

  1. Convenience: You can walk at any time and in any weather condition without leaving your home.
  2. Adjustability: Most treadmills provide adjustable speed settings and incline choices to customize workouts to individual fitness levels.
  3. Joint Health: Walking is usually easier on the joints compared to running, making it a more suitable option for lots of individuals.
  4. Physical fitness Tracking: Many contemporary treadmills come equipped with fitness tracking functions, enabling users to monitor their development.
  5. Multitasking: Walking on a treadmill enables users to take part in other activities like seeing TV, reading, or working at a standing desk.

Secret Features to Consider When Buying a Walking Treadmill

When selecting a walking treadmill, several features can substantially boost the user experience. Consider the following:

Feature Description
Size and Space Assess the offered space in your house. Collapsible options conserve area but may have smaller sized running surface areas.
Motor Power A motor score of a minimum of 1.5 HP is ideal for walking; appearance for higher rankings if jogging is likewise thought about.
Speed Range Many users require an optimal speed of around 10 km/h (6.2 mph) for walking; guarantee the treadmill has this ability.
Shock Absorption Good treadmills featured cushioning systems to lessen influence on joints and boost comfort during workouts.
Display Features Try to find a display that reveals important metrics (time, speed, distance, calories burned) to keep an eye on workout performance.
Warranty and Support Examine warranties for parts and labor; reliable brand names normally provide substantial coverage for at least one year.
Cost Treadmill rates can vary substantially; establish a budget and stick to it while guaranteeing the vital features are met.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Are walking treadmills suitable for everybody?

Yes, walking treadmills are usually ideal for all fitness levels. However, those with pre-existing health conditions ought to speak with a physician before beginning a new exercise program.

2. What is the average life-span of a walking treadmill?

Many walking treadmills have a lifespan of 7 to 12 years, depending upon usage, upkeep, and develop quality.

3. Can I customize my workouts on a walking treadmill?

Certainly! Numerous walking treadmills permit customizable exercise programs, speed adjustments, and slope settings to fulfill private physical fitness objectives.

4. Just how much area do I need for a walking treadmill?

Area requirements vary by model. Step the location where you mean to position the treadmill and compare that with the measurements of the desired design, including sufficient area for walking conveniently.
